Wood in the living area – live naturally, live consciously

Wood is much more than just a material. It brings warmth, structure and life to every room and influences our well-being in a completely natural way. Wooden furniture, lights, room dividers and decorations create an atmosphere in which you feel relaxed, focused and secure.

The natural grain, warm color palette and organic shapes of wood have a calming effect and promote a harmonious indoor climate. Studies show that people in rooms with wood feel less stress and experience an increased quality of life. Even small accents, such as a wooden lamp or a side table made of natural wood, can noticeably change the effect of the room.

Wood is also a durable and sustainable material that retains its beauty for decades. Furniture made of solid wood or root wood is not only functional, but also an expression of a conscious living style that values ​​quality, nature and longevity.

Whether as a dining table, coffee table, room divider, floor lamp or decorative element - wood combines design and naturalness. It creates spaces in which you feel comfortable, are inspired and can express your own personality. With wood in the living area, every room becomes a place of peace, aesthetics and quality of life.

The effect of wood – more than just a piece of furniture

Wood works on several levels: It influences the acoustics of a room, regulates the room climate through natural moisture absorption and radiates a visible warmth that can be felt immediately. Rooms with wood feel cozy, elegant and lively at the same time.

In addition, wood promotes mindfulness and conscious living. Anyone who chooses natural materials relies on sustainability, longevity and an environment that supports well-being. Even small details such as wooden strips, lamp bases or decorative elements contribute to the overall effect and make the home unique.

Using wood in the living area creates a harmonious interplay of aesthetics, nature and function. It is the perfect basis for a home that conveys security, inspiration and balance - whether minimalist, modern or luxurious.
